This document provides guidance on how to set SMART (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, Time-bound) goals for marketing. It recommends that goals be specific, measurable with key performance indicators, achievable but still challenging, relevant to your brand or business, and have a clear timeline. Studies have shown that setting specific goals and monitoring progress regularly can significantly increase performance outcomes. The document also suggests breaking goals down into actionable steps and holding team members accountable for progress updates to help ensure goals are achieved.
